Abstract:We examine if well-managed firms using the same strategy perform a lot better or just a little better than their competitors. Supermarket industry was chosen as it is large and highly competitive. Success in the supermarket business seems to be the result of either cost leadership, or service leadership. The cost leaders earn high net income through low gross margins, and low operating expenses. Service leaders also earn high net income, based on high gross margins and high operating expenses.
